Job Summary

Carl Buddig and Company OWS is seeking a highly skilled Smoker I to join our production team. As a Smoker I, you will play a critical role in ensuring the quality and safety of our products.

Key Responsibilities
  • Food Safety and Quality Control: Develop and maintain a working knowledge of the HACCP program, including Critical Control Points and Critical Limits.
  • Product Testing and Inspection: Conduct testing to ensure cooking requirements are met, working closely with other departments.
  • Equipment Operation and Maintenance: Push/pull racks in and out of the smoke houses and ovens, monitor ovens and smoke houses during cooking, and review processing schedules.
  • Cleaning and Sanitation: Clean related equipment and maintain a clean and safe work environment.
  • Product Handling and Distribution: Issue cooked product to packaging or directly to production departments, following outlined Quality SOPs and guidelines.
Requirements
  • Education: High School Diploma or equivalent.
  • Experience: 1-3 years of manufacturing, high-speed packaging, or food manufacturing experience.
  • Skills and Knowledge: Proven track record of acceptable levels of attendance, safety, and quality of work; basic understanding of GMPs, HACCP, and SQF guidelines; mathematical skills; good oral and written communication skills; ability to use measurement tools; and strong knowledge of AX software, net weight program, and craft sheets.
  • Physical and Work Environment Requirements: Ability to stand/walk for 8-9 hours per day; lift, push, pull up to 75 pounds on a regular basis, up to 100 pounds occasionally; bend, twist, stoop, and squat; good hand and eye coordination; and ability to work in temperatures of 40 degrees or less, as well as very warm temperatures of 80 degrees or higher.
